What to Look for: Organic Boho Style

My suggestion? Go big. One big accessory, such as the 15″ wide faux coral below, is going to make a much bigger impact in your room than multiple small shells would.

To create a similar affect, you could group shells in one large container. This large wood and glass case was another great find.

You could easily add big shells or driftwood inside for a great display, or fill it with a natural looking faux plant for effortless greenery. Putting some real plants around it will add to the illusion!

These rustic looking wood stands are also perfect for display. Stack one on top of a side table to add height. Then try adding a plant or something like the large faux coral to create a focal point. Have fun arranging your organic boho accessories until you’re happy with how it looks.

Keep in mind, adding height with a case or these stands, will make your focal point pop!

A splash of bold natural color is another way to add an organic vibe. Take these pots for example. Although they can be used outside, they would also look great on top of your wooden stand, filled with either a faux or real plant. By adding great texture along with rustic looking wood you’re complementing the natural vibe.
